Différences entre versions de « Xming »

 
(30 versions intermédiaires par un autre utilisateur non affichées)
Ligne 3 : Ligne 3 :
 
[[Image:XmingLogo.png|thumb]]
 
[[Image:XmingLogo.png|thumb]]
  
'''Xming''' permet de rediriger des applications graphiques depuis une machine du réseau du DMS (ou d'ESIBAC) sur votre ordinateur Windows.
+
'''Xming''' permet de rediriger des applications graphiques depuis une machine du réseau DMS (étudiants gradués), du [[Compte_MAS|réseau MAS]] ou encore du réseau [http://www.esi.umontreal.ca/ ESIBAC] sur votre ordinateur Windows.
 +
__TOC__
 +
== Guide ==
  
[[Image:Attention.png | 40px]] Veuillez noter que nous vous suggérons d'employer plutôt le logiciel [[NoMachine_NX|NoMachine NX]] en raison des meilleures performances que ce logiciel propose.
+
Xming est un serveur X (interface graphique) qui utilise une connexion [[La_commande_ssh|ssh]]. Il faut donc l'employer conjointement à un logiciel comme [[PuTTY|PuTTY]] qui permet d'établir la liaison ssh.
  
__TOC__
+
Dans ce qui suit, nous allons supposer que l'usager a préalablement installé et configuré [[PuTTY|PuTTY]] sur sa machine. Consultez la [[PuTTY|page dédiée]] pour la procédure.
  
== Guide ==
+
=== Téléchargement de Xming ===
=== Installation et utilisation de Xming pour Windows ===
+
* Téléchargez Xming depuis http://sourceforge.net/projects/xming/.
 +
* Choisissez l'option ''Sauvegardez le fichier'' '''Xming-***-setup.exe'''.
 +
* Double-cliquez sur le fichier pour démarrer l'installation :
 +
** ''The publisher could not be verified. Are you sure you want to run this software?'' Cliquez sur ''Run''.
 +
** Si un message d'alerte ''Do you want to allow the following program from an unknown publisher to make changes to this computer?'' s'ouvre, cliquez ''Yes''.
 +
* Poursuivez l'installation en cliquant sur ''Next'' plusieurs fois. Vous pouvez cocher l'option d'ajout de l'icône de Xming sur le bureau.
 +
* Avant de terminer l'installation, cochez la case ''Launch Xming'' puis cliquez sur ''Finish''.
  
Xming est un serveur X qui utilise une communication SSH. Vous devez utiliser un logiciel qui vous permet d'établir des connexions SSH : PuTTY est une application Windows pour communiquer par SSH. Elle permet de travailler en ligne de commandes sur un ordinateur distant.
+
=== Utilisation de Xming ===
+
* Lors du démarrage, si une alerte du pare-feu Windows (''Firewall'') apparaît, cliquez sur ''Allow access''.
* Téléchargez et installez PuTTY: consultez la page dédiée à [[PuTTY|l'installation de PuTTY]].
+
[[Image:AllowAccessXming.png]]
* Téléchargez Xming pour Windows depuis http://sourceforge.net/projects/xming/.
+
* L'icône de Xming apparaissant dans la barre des tâches (en bas sur votre bureau) signifie que le serveur X est actif.
* Choisissez l'option '''Sauvegardez le fichier''' ****setup.exe.
+
[[Image:XmingPrintScreen4.png]]
* Double-cliquez sur ce fichier dans la fenêtre des téléchargements; une fenêtre s'ouvre :
+
* Démarrez [[PuTTY|PuTTY]].
[[Fichier:Dot.png|link=]]''The publisher could not be verified. Are you sure you want to run this software?'' Cliquez sur '''Run'''.<br/>
+
* Dans le menu de gauche, sélectionnez ''Connection'' puis le sous-menu ''SSH'' et, dans ce sous-menu, cliquez sur ''X11''.
[[Fichier:Dot.png|link=]]Si un message d'alerte ''Do you want to allow the following program from an unknown publisher to make changes to this computer?'' s'ouvre, cliquez '''Yes'''.
 
* Poursuivez l'installation en cliquant sur '''next''' plusieurs fois, vous pouvez cocher l'option d'ajout d'un icône sur le bureau puis terminer l'installation en cliquant sur '''install'''.
 
* Lancez Xming.
 
* Si une alerte apparaît, cliquez '''Allow access'''.
 
[[Fichier:AllowAccessXming.png|link=]]
 
* L'icône du serveur X Xming apparaît dans la barre des tâches en bas sur votre bureau signifiant que le serveur est actif.
 
[[Fichier:XmingPrintScreen4.png|link=]]
 
* Lancez PuTTY.
 
* Dans le menu de gauche sélectionnez '''Connection''' puis le sous-menu '''SSH''', et dans ce sous-menu, cliquez sur '''X11''' :
 
 
* Sélectionnez ''Enable X11 forwarding''.
 
* Sélectionnez ''Enable X11 forwarding''.
[[Fichier:PuTTYX11.png|link=]]
+
[[Image:PuTTYX11.png]]
* Dans le menu session, selon le cas, configurez la connexion au réseau du DMS ou à ESIBAC en suivant le [[PuTTY#Utilisation_de_PuTTY|guide d'utilisation de PuTTY]].
+
* Cliquez sur ''Open'' en bas de la fenêtre.
* Cliquez sur '''Open''' en bas de la fenêtre.
 
 
* Une fenêtre de terminal s'ouvre.
 
* Une fenêtre de terminal s'ouvre.
* Entrez votre login et mot de passe du DMS ou d'ESIBAC.
+
* Entrez votre login et mot de passe pour vous authentifier.
* Vous êtes à présent connecté sur la machine Tardif du réseau du DMS ou au réseau ESIBAC.
 
  
----
+
=== Connexion au réseau DMS ===
 +
Veuillez noter que la plupart des logiciels ne sont pas accessibles depuis la machine <tt>euler</tt>, la machine d'entrée au réseau DMS&nbsp;: il faut vous connecter à une autre machine.
  
=== Pour une connexion au réseau DMS ===
+
Pour connaître le nom d'une machine disponible, entrez [[La_commande_simulation|<tt>simulation</tt>]] dans le terminal. Vous pouvez accéder aux machines énumérées avec la commande [[La_commande_ssh|<tt>ssh</tt>]] munie de l'option <tt>-X</tt>; par exemple&nbsp;:
[[Fichier:Dot.png|link=]]Veuillez noter que la plupart des logiciels ne sont pas accessibles depuis Tardif. Il faut vous connecter sur une autre machine.
+
<pre>
* Pour connaître le nom de la machine disponible, tapez simulation :
+
ssh -X loup
<pre>tardif [~] >simulation
+
</pre>
 
+
pour vous brancher à la machine <tt>loup</tt> de [[labomat|<tt>labomat</tt>]].
Nous vous rappelons que les ressources informatiques du laboratoire
 
doivent rester disponibles et performantes pour tous.
 
Par respect pour les autres usagers, nous vous demandons donc
 
de ne pas monopoliser les stations en lancant plus de 3
 
simulations simultanées.
 
Si vous avez des besoins plus importants, veuillez consulter votre
 
coadministrateur.
 
Veuillez noter aussi que cette commande étudie le taux d'occupation
 
des stations à l'instant ou vous l'executez et elle ne reserve en aucun
 
cas un poste. Vous devez donc utiliser ce script juste avant de lancer
 
votre simulation.
 
  
.....
+
Vous pouvez à présent lancez un logiciel nécessitant l'interface graphique sur la machine distante. Par exemple,
 
+
<pre>
 
+
mathematica
La station disponible est : '''simulation5'''
 
 
</pre>
 
</pre>
 
+
démarre le logiciel [[Mathematica|Mathematica]].
* Connectez vous en interne sur la machine disponible par SSH avec l'option -X : tapez la commande <pre>ssh simulation5 -X</pre>
 
* Lancez le logiciel : par exemple <pre>mathematica</pre>
 
  
 
== Voir aussi ==
 
== Voir aussi ==
  
 
=== Articles connexes ===
 
=== Articles connexes ===
 +
<div class="inline">
 
* [[logiciels|Logiciels au DMS]]
 
* [[logiciels|Logiciels au DMS]]
 
* [[FileZilla|FileZilla]]
 
* [[FileZilla|FileZilla]]
* [[NetDrive|NetDrive]]
 
 
* [[NoMachine_NX|NoMachine NX]]
 
* [[NoMachine_NX|NoMachine NX]]
* [[pftp|pftp]]
+
* [[psftp|psftp]]
 
* [[pscp|pscp]]
 
* [[pscp|pscp]]
 
* [[PuTTY|PuTTY]]
 
* [[PuTTY|PuTTY]]
 
+
</div>
 
=== Références externes ===
 
=== Références externes ===
 +
<div class="inline">
 
* [http://www.straightrunning.com/XmingNotes/ Site officiel de Xming]
 
* [http://www.straightrunning.com/XmingNotes/ Site officiel de Xming]
 
* [http://fr.wikipedia.org/wiki/Xming Xming sur Wikipédia]
 
* [http://fr.wikipedia.org/wiki/Xming Xming sur Wikipédia]
 +
</div>

Version actuelle datée du 3 décembre 2020 à 20:59


XmingLogo.png

Xming permet de rediriger des applications graphiques depuis une machine du réseau DMS (étudiants gradués), du réseau MAS ou encore du réseau ESIBAC sur votre ordinateur Windows.

Guide

Xming est un serveur X (interface graphique) qui utilise une connexion ssh. Il faut donc l'employer conjointement à un logiciel comme PuTTY qui permet d'établir la liaison ssh.

Dans ce qui suit, nous allons supposer que l'usager a préalablement installé et configuré PuTTY sur sa machine. Consultez la page dédiée pour la procédure.

Téléchargement de Xming

  • Téléchargez Xming depuis http://sourceforge.net/projects/xming/.
  • Choisissez l'option Sauvegardez le fichier Xming-***-setup.exe.
  • Double-cliquez sur le fichier pour démarrer l'installation :
    • The publisher could not be verified. Are you sure you want to run this software? Cliquez sur Run.
    • Si un message d'alerte Do you want to allow the following program from an unknown publisher to make changes to this computer? s'ouvre, cliquez Yes.
  • Poursuivez l'installation en cliquant sur Next plusieurs fois. Vous pouvez cocher l'option d'ajout de l'icône de Xming sur le bureau.
  • Avant de terminer l'installation, cochez la case Launch Xming puis cliquez sur Finish.

Utilisation de Xming

  • Lors du démarrage, si une alerte du pare-feu Windows (Firewall) apparaît, cliquez sur Allow access.

AllowAccessXming.png

  • L'icône de Xming apparaissant dans la barre des tâches (en bas sur votre bureau) signifie que le serveur X est actif.

XmingPrintScreen4.png

  • Démarrez PuTTY.
  • Dans le menu de gauche, sélectionnez Connection puis le sous-menu SSH et, dans ce sous-menu, cliquez sur X11.
  • Sélectionnez Enable X11 forwarding.

PuTTYX11.png

  • Cliquez sur Open en bas de la fenêtre.
  • Une fenêtre de terminal s'ouvre.
  • Entrez votre login et mot de passe pour vous authentifier.

Connexion au réseau DMS

Veuillez noter que la plupart des logiciels ne sont pas accessibles depuis la machine euler, la machine d'entrée au réseau DMS : il faut vous connecter à une autre machine.

Pour connaître le nom d'une machine disponible, entrez simulation dans le terminal. Vous pouvez accéder aux machines énumérées avec la commande ssh munie de l'option -X; par exemple :

ssh -X loup

pour vous brancher à la machine loup de labomat.

Vous pouvez à présent lancez un logiciel nécessitant l'interface graphique sur la machine distante. Par exemple,

mathematica

démarre le logiciel Mathematica.

Voir aussi

Articles connexes

Références externes


La dernière modification de cette page a été faite le 3 décembre 2020 à 20:59.